Newark commands the A1/A46 crossroads on the Nottinghamshire and Lincolnshire border and hosts one of the strategic East Coast Main Line rail-freight interchanges. Bowbridge Industrial Estate on the southern edge of the town anchors the mature light-manufacturing and distribution stock, Brunel Drive covers the modern speculative light-industrial and B2B footprint, and the NG24 hinterland picks up substantial food-processing, aggregates and Trent Valley logistics activity. National Grid Electricity Distribution's Newark primary carries reasonable headroom.

Solar yield

Newark sits in the Midlands irradiance band — roughly 950–1,000 kWh per kWp per yearstrong UK commercial solar yield, especially on large flat or shallow-pitch roofs.

Commercial solar in Newark — FAQs

Are Bowbridge roofs typically PV-ready?

The 1990s and 2000s speculative stock uses standing-seam and profiled-steel roofs well suited to non-penetrative clamp mounting. Older units at the western fringe use asbestos-cement and need overroof or replacement scoped into the same project window.

How does NGED handle NG24 G99?

Sub-500 kWp with export limitation typically completes acceptance inside 10–12 weeks on the Bowbridge and Brunel Drive feeders. The Newark primary carries reasonable headroom and 1 MWp+ arrays remain workable via Design Variation on the Trent Valley 33 kV.

Do rail-freight interchange loads suit rooftop PV?

Well — reach-stacker charging, refrigerated container conditioning and warehouse HVAC carry sustained daytime demand and self-consume rooftop PV in the mid-to-high 80s of percent.

What yield does an NG24 rooftop deliver?

Around 950–990 kWh per kWp per year on shallow east-west arrays and up to around 1,020 on a south-facing pitch. Trent Valley low-cloud winter weather trims Q1 output but summer generation compensates strongly.
